Here is why Portable Transmission-Qt is the ultimate lightweight choice for managing your downloads. What is Portable Transmission-Qt?
Transmission is famous for being the default, lightweight torrent client on many Linux distributions. Transmission-Qt is the Windows version built using the Qt user interface framework. The “Portable” version takes this a step further by packaging the entire application so it can run without being installed on a local operating system. Key Advantages of the Portable Version 1. Zero Installation, Maximum Portability
Portable applications do not require a standard installation process. You can download the program files, drop them onto a USB flash drive, an external hard drive, or a cloud storage folder, and run the client instantly on any Windows machine. 2. No Registry Bloat
Standard software installations often scatter files across your system drive and leave behind entries in the Windows Registry. Portable Transmission-Qt keeps all its configuration files, settings, and active torrent data inside its own single folder. When you delete the folder, the program is completely gone from the computer, leaving zero footprint behind. 3. Open-Source and Ad-Free
Unlike competitor clients that bombard users with flashing banner ads, premium tier upsells, and hidden telemetry tracking, Transmission is completely open-source. It contains no advertisements, no malware, and no bundled third-party software. Powerhouse Features in a Tiny Footprint
Do not let the minimal design fool you. Portable Transmission-Qt includes all the essential features required by advanced users:
Low Resource Consumption: It uses significantly less RAM and CPU power than alternative clients, making it ideal for older laptops, budget PCs, or low-powered windows tablets.
Encryption and Security: Supports full peer-to-peer encryption, DHT, PEX, and Magnet links to protect your privacy and maximize connection stability.
Remote Management: Features a built-in web interface. You can securely control your home downloads from a mobile phone or another computer browser.
Speed Limits and Scheduling: Easily set global or individual speed caps for uploads and downloads, or schedule them to change automatically during specific hours of the day. How to Get Started
Using Portable Transmission-Qt is incredibly straightforward:
Download the Portable Transmission-Qt package from a trusted portable software repository (such as PortableApps).
Extract the contents of the ZIP or self-extracting archive to your preferred location (e.g., a USB drive).
Open the folder and double-click the executable file (usually Transmission-QtPortable.exe) to launch the client.
Drag and drop a .torrent file or click a magnet link to begin downloading immediately. Conclusion
